CORGI Or Gas Safe?

CORGI has been dissolved as the official gas engineer register in 2009, but many people continue to refer to themselves as being "corgi gas engineer near me registered". This is potentially dangerous for gas engineer consumers.

natural-gas-stove-2023-11-27-05-05-29-utc-min-scaled.jpgIn England alone, over 60 deaths occur each year from carbon monoxide poisoning. It is therefore crucial that you hire an engineer certified to work with gas. work on your boiler or other appliances.

Checking your ID card

In the UK all gas engineers and businesses have to be registered with Gas Safe Register (previously known as CORGI). They are licensed to conduct any work related to a gas appliance like boiler installation maintenance, repair or an annual safety inspection. Only Gas Safe registered engineers can operate on your gas appliances. They will be issued the certificate which shows their registration number and photo, as well as an inventory of different types of jobs they are certified to perform in your home.

It's a good idea request the engineer to show you their ID card prior to beginning any work. However, if they don't have one or it has expired, you must refuse to let them work on your gas appliances. You can check their registration details online to confirm they're registered with Gas Safe Register.

Capita is the new operator of Gas Safe Register, which replaced CORGI. It's the only entity that can legally operate in the GB gas industry, and all engineers must be registered with it. It is illegal for engineers to work on gas installations unless registered with the body.

Gas Safe registered engineers will be issued a green ID card that has an expiry date of five years. A registered Gas Safe engineer will also have a valid telephone number and address. You can verify whether an engineer is a registered on the Gas Safe Register by searching their website for their name.

To be certified as a gas engineer an individual must have completed their training and have gained experience working on gas installations. The individual must also have passed an investigation into their criminal record and not have a past record of fraud or malpractice. However, there are still many unregistered engineers in the UK who perform work that puts their clients and colleagues at risk. Unregistered engineers may not be aware of the dangers of CO poisoning, and may not have been taught to recognize signs. The best way to prevent these issues is to only use Gas Safe registered engineers.

Verifying the experience of the engineer

Gas engineers are vital to modern-day living, since they ensure that heating systems and other appliances in the home function smoothly and efficiently. Gas engineers also manage more complex gas systems, which are utilized by restaurants, hotels and other companies. Gas safety is a crucial issue, with 60 deaths a year in the UK due to carbon monoxide poisoning.

It is essential to check the qualifications and experience of a gas engineer (damgaard-Rivers.technetbloggers.de) before hiring them. The number of certifications they have and the length of training are a good way to determine the level of expertise of an engineer. Training to become a gas engineer typically lasts about 26 weeks and includes classroom instruction and gas engineer practical workshops. In addition, trainees will undergo a work-study to gain practical experience in the industry.

After years of pressure from the public and industry, CORGI was replaced by the Gas Safe Register in 2009. A review of gas safety in 2006 resulted in a decision change to a different registration body. The Gas Safe Register, operated by Capita under contract, is staffed with HSE-approved personnel.

It is available on the internet and is accessible to consumers at no cost. It includes gas fitters, gas engineers and other gas professionals that are registered with the government. The register is regularly updated and includes information about the qualifications of each individual and their employment background.
